Currently on a cycle of.

Monday (Upper chest conjugate/Biceps heavy)

A. Incline bench press
4 x 6-8 reps

B1. Low-incline dumbbell press (stop short of lockout)
3 x 10-12 reps

B2. Incline cable flies
3 x 10-12 reps

C. Low-pulley crossover
3 x 8-10 reps

D. Bench press
1 x 100 reps (take pauses if needed)

E. Barbell curl
5 x 5 reps


Tuesday (Quads/Hams)

A1. Back squat
1 x 15, 1 x 12, 1 x 8, 1 x 20

A2. Romanian deadlift
1 x 12, 1 x 10, 1 x 8, 1 x 15

B1. Leg press
3 x 10-12 reps

B2. Gironda leg curl (leg curl with an elevated torso, as in a push-up position)
3 x 10-12 reps

C. Leg curl
1 x 100 reps


Thursday (Biceps conjugate/Upper chest heavy)

A. Barbell curl
4 x 6-8 reps

B1. Reverse preacher curl
3 x 10-12 reps

B2. Hammer curl
3 x 10-12 reps

C. Machine curl 2/1 technique (lift with 2 arms, lower in 5 seconds with 1 arm)
3 x 5-6 reps per side

D. Preacher curl
1 x 100 reps

E. High incline dumbbell press
5 x 5


Saturday (Back/Triceps)

A1. Barbell rowing
3 x 6-8 reps

A2. Fat-man pull-ups
3 x max reps

B1. Weighted chins
3 x 6-8 reps

B2. Lat pulldown
3 x 10-12 reps

C1. Decline EZ-bar triceps extension
5 x 6-8 reps

C2. Rope triceps extension
5 x 12-15 reps

Ab work is performed after every workout.

4mi run on off day.

I workout 3 days a week.

Chest/tricpes

Back/Biceps

Shoulders/Legs

I usually alternate between heavy weight/less reps and lighter weight/more reps.

Ab work is included at the end of every workout. As for the cardio, I'm not a big runner, but when I do run, its usually more of a jog. When not running, I'll walk at a good pace for 30 min. This is usually done on a treadmill. The road that runs through my condo complex is a 1/2 mi. around, so when I'm walking outside, which is usually done with the dog, I'll go around a minimum of 2 times to a max of 5. I do this at least 3 times before heading out to work, so I average at least 3 miles broken up.
